Re: Disney and car rentals

Depends on the resort. CSR and CBR are both very spread out. We had one for POR and felt it was a waste. We took the bus to MK bc you don't want to drive to the MK. We did not take it to the others but the buses were coming nicely. If you rent you miss out on ME which made it so easy. CBR for example has an internal shuttle you might need to take dependant on your room. POFQ only has 7 buildings. Their buses are very easy.

Re: Disney and car rentals

I would say it depends on what your planning to do while on Vacation.

Disney provides transportation throughout the Parks for Resort Guests and you can even use Disney's FREE Magical Express from the airport to Disney. We use their services every vacation and have had no issues.

However, if you plan on venturing outside Disney than to me it would make sense to maybe rent a car for a few days.

We stayed at All Star Movies this past April and the bus service was awful, especially to the MK. We would wait and wait and wait early in the morning, while other buses came and went more than once for the other parks. I actually complained when I came home about it (and several other things), and was compensated, which I really wasn't expecting.

We stayed at Wilderness Lodge last December, and took the boat to the MK, loved it! Hardly ever waited for a bus, BUT it took forever to get anywhere with the stops at the other resorts.
